Abstract
A medical image processing device includes a processor including hardware. The processor is configured to: acquire a real image acquired by imaging of an observation target; execute cut-out processing of generating a cut-out image by cutting out at least a part of a three-dimensional image that is based on plural tomographic images having the observation target captured therein; execute shade and shadow processing of adding shade or a shadow to the cut-out image, based on illumination condition information indicating an illumination condition for the observation target in the imaging of the real image; and execute superimposition processing of generating a superimposed image by superimposing the cut-out image that has been subjected to the shade and shadow processing, on the real image.
